CHICAGO (Jan. 8, 2026) – Chicago Fire FC Homegrown player Dylan Borso has been called up to the U.S. U-20 Men’s National Team for a domestic training camp from Jan. 10-17, 2026, in Mesa, Ariz.  

Borso will join 15 other players on Rob Valentino’s squad for a second time, following a training camp in August 2025. The team will train concurrently with the U.S. U-18 and U-19 Men’s National Teams, which will include Chicago Fire U-18 Academy defender Kruz Held. 

In December 2024, Borso became the 25th Homegrown Player in Club history, and the 11th to sign with the Fire since January 2020. A native of Chicago, Borso was part of Chicago Fire Youth Soccer before he joined the Chicago Fire Academy in 2017, contributing to Academy squads from the U-13 through the U-19 levels, as well as Chicago Fire II of MLS NEXT Pro. Borso has played in 32 matches for Chicago Fire II since making his debut in 2023 as a 17-year-old. In 2025, he played in 24 matches (19 starts), scored three goals and registered one assist.
